2025年の必須科目!小学校のプログラミング教育の内容とは?

2025年、小学校のプログラミング教育がさらに充実し、教育課程に組み込まれることが決まっています。この変化は、子どもたちが未来に向けて必要なスキルを身につけるために不可欠な一歩となります。では、2025年の小学校におけるプログラミング教育の内容とは、具体的にどのようなものなのでしょうか?

プログラミング教育は、従来の「知識を覚える」学習から「問題を解決する」学習へとシフトしています。このアプローチは、子どもたちが実際に手を動かして学びながら、問題解決の方法を身につけることを目的としています。2025年のプログラミング教育では、単なるコードを書くことにとどまらず、子どもたちが自分で問題を見つけ、解決策を考え、そしてその解決策を実際にプログラムとして実行する能力を育てることが重視されます。

このため、プログラミング教育では、まず基本的なプログラミング言語を学ぶことが求められます。Scratchなどのビジュアルプログラミングから始め、次第にJavaScriptやPythonなど、より高度な言語へと進むことが考えられています。しかし、プログラムを書くことが目的ではなく、子どもたちが「どうやって問題を解決するか」を考え、チームで協力してプロジェクトを進めることが重要です。

また、2025年のプログラミング教育では、具体的なツールとして「ゲーム開発」を取り入れることが注目されています。Unityなどを使ったゲーム制作は、子どもたちにとって魅力的でありながら、プログラミングの基本を学ぶには最適な方法です。ゲーム開発を通じて、子どもたちは「物語の進行」「キャラクターの動き」「エフェクト」などの要素をプログラミングし、実際に動作するゲームを作成します。このプロセスを通じて、子どもたちは問題解決力や論理的思考力を身につけることができます。

さらに、2025年にはAIやIoT(Internet of Things)などの最新技術を取り入れた教材も登場する予定です。これらの技術を使ったプログラミングを学ぶことで、子どもたちは未来のテクノロジーに対する理解を深め、将来的な職業選択においても有利に働くでしょう。

このようなプログラミング教育を通じて、子どもたちは今後の社会で求められる「創造力」「論理的思考」「チームワーク」を育みます。そして、プログラミング教育が未来の必須科目となることで、子どもたちの可能性は無限に広がります。


★monopro キッズ・プログラミング道場

教室見学・体験はこちらより